Sensor Wiring

All flow sensor types connect to the four terminal headers labeled “Sensor Input ”

Series 200

Connect the red wire to sensor signal (+), black wire to sensor signal (–) and the bare wire to shield

SDI Series

Connect the plus (+) terminal of the sensor to sensor signal (+) on the transmitter and the minus (–) terminal of the sensor to

sensor signal (–) on the transmitter Connect the shield terminal of the sensor to the shield terminal of the transmitter

Other Flow Sensors

The sensor input power out terminal supplies nominal 12V DC excitation voltage for three-wire sensors Connect sensor signal

(+) and sensor signal (–) wires to transmitter terminals
The 340 BN/MB Btu Energy Transmitter is very versatile and can accept both pulse and zero crossing sine wave flow sensors

Excitation voltage is also provided for three-wire powered sensors (Example: hall effect, of Badger Meter Series 4000)
See the Programming section

page 14

for configuration instructions
